4. The graph shows hourly temperatures from 5 AM to 5 PM. What is the range of temperatures?
Answer: A
The range of temperatures is 20 °F.
The range of temperatures can be determined by finding the difference between the highest and lowest temperatures recorded on the graph. In this case, the highest temperature is 70 °F, and the lowest is 50 °F, resulting in a range of 20 °F.
